What is A Structural Data Acquisition System about?

For structural testing of the External Tank element of the Space Shuttle Project, a generalized Data Acquisition System (DAS) was developed. The system is centered around 2 Varian V73 comanalog-to-digital converters. The 4 types od data input are deflections, pressures, load cells and strain gauges. Also, 4 self-test channels are included to verify the analog-todigital converters during testing. The software consists of 5 separate programs, two of which run concurrently during the structural test. One program acquires the data while the other is the operator interface. The other three programs create a test dependent data base from card input, obtain and store the initial condition, and finally list the results in a convenient form. Modifications required because of test experience are described, in addition to improvements to be made should a similiar system be created in the future.
